How much do part time office work j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time office work in Nebraska is $18.05,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.34 and $20.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is part time office work?

Part time office work refers to administrative or clerical duties performed in an office setting for fewer hours per week than a standard full-time position, often ranging from 10 to 30 hours. Tasks may include answering phones, filing documents, data entry, scheduling appointments, and other supportive activities. These roles offer flexibility, making them ideal for students, parents, or anyone seeking supplemental income or work-life balance. Part time office work can be found in a variety of industries, including healthcare, education, and business services.

What are some common challenges faced in part time office work, and how can they be managed effectively?

Part-time office workers often face challenges related to time management and communication, as they may not be present during all office hours or meetings. To manage these challenges, it's important to prioritize tasks, stay organized, and proactively communicate with supervisors and colleagues about your schedule and progress. Leveraging digital tools for collaboration and making sure to keep updated on company announcements can also help ensure you stay connected and effective in your role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in part time office work?

To thrive in part time office work, you need basic administrative skills, proficiency in word processing,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with office software like Microsoft Office Suite or Google Workspace and experience with office equipment are typically required. Str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ication help you stand out in this role. These skills ensure that office operations run smoothly and efficiently, supporting overall business productivity.
